    A boundlessly thin shell constrained by a couple of similar surfaces with nearly identical orientations.

词源

From homoe- + -oid, from Ancient Greek: ὅμοιος (hómoios, “of like kind”, “similar”) in conjunction with εἶδος (eîdos, “form, likeness”).
